Gentoo Linux Security Advisory                           GLSA 202006-23
-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-
                                           https://security.gentoo.org/
-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-

 Severity: Normal
    Title: Cyrus IMAP Server: Access restriction bypass
     Date: June 15, 2020
     Bugs: #703630
       ID: 202006-23

-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-

Synopsis
=======
An error in Cyrus IMAP Server allows mailboxes to be created with
administrative privileges.

Background
=========
The Cyrus IMAP Server is an efficient, highly-scalable IMAP e-mail
server.

Affected packages
================
    -------------------------------------------------------------------
     Package              /     Vulnerable     /            Unaffected
    -------------------------------------------------------------------
  1  net-mail/cyrus-imapd         < 3.0.13                  >= 3.0.13 

Description
==========
An issue was discovered in Cyrus IMAP Server where sieve script
uploading is excessively trusted.

Impact
=====
A user can use a sieve script to create any mailbox with administrator
privileges.

Workaround
=========
Disable sieve script uploading until the upgrade is complete.

Resolution
=========
All Cyrus IMAP Server users should upgrade to the latest version:

  # emerge --sync
  # em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ose ">=net-mail/cyrus-imapd-3.0.13"
